Abstract

Electro-oxidation is a promising green technology for decentralized wastewater purification. However, its efficacy is primarily constrained by the selectivity and efficiency of hydroxyl radical (•OH) generation through one-electron water oxidation. In this study, we elucidate the mechanism of electronic metal-support interactions (EMSI) of Ni single-atoms on antimony-doped tin oxide anode (Ni/ATO) to enhance •OH production and overall water treatment efficiency. We experimentally and theoretically investigate both the structural evolution process and micro-interface mechanisms associated with the EMSI effects induced by Ni single-atoms. The optimized electronic structures in the interfacial catalysts under EMSI conditions and the co-catalytic role of Ni single-atoms synergistically facilitate selective and efficient •OH generation, resulting in over a fivefold increase in its steady-state concentration and tenfold enhancement in pseudo-first-order rate constant of sulfamethoxazole degradation compared to those on bare ATO. With the EMSI, rapid electron transfer channels were established for a marked enhancement in the adsorption, conversion, and dissociation of interfacial HO molecules. Notably, it is revealed that Ni single-atoms serve as co-catalytic sites, exhibiting a "H-pulling effect" that is crucial for •OH generation. The Ni/ATO anode demonstrates great efficiency in degrading various refractory organic pollutants, and effectively treats real pharmaceutical wastewater with low energy consumption. Furthermore, it presents remarkable stability and adaptability, while maintaining a minimal environmental footprint during wastewater treatment processes. This work addresses the theoretical gaps between EMSI effects and co-catalysis in electro-oxidation systems, while providing a robust technological solution for wastewater purification.

摘要

电氧化是一种很有前景的用于分散式废水净化的绿色技术。然而,其功效主要受限于通过单电子水氧化产生羟基自由基(•OH)的选择性和效率。在本研究中,我们阐明了镍单原子在锑掺杂氧化锡阳极(Ni/ATO)上的电子金属-载体相互作用(EMSI)机制,以提高•OH的产生量和整体水处理效率。我们通过实验和理论研究了与镍单原子诱导的EMSI效应相关的结构演变过程和微界面机制。在EMSI条件下,界面催化剂中优化的电子结构以及镍单原子的共催化作用协同促进了选择性和高效的•OH生成,与裸ATO相比,其稳态浓度增加了五倍以上,磺胺甲恶唑降解的准一级速率常数提高了十倍。通过EMSI,建立了快速电子转移通道,显著增强了界面HO分子的吸附、转化和解离。值得注意的是,研究发现镍单原子作为共催化位点,表现出对•OH生成至关重要的“氢提取效应”。Ni/ATO阳极在降解各种难降解有机污染物方面表现出很高的效率,并且能以低能耗有效处理实际制药废水。此外,它还具有出色的稳定性和适应性,同时在废水处理过程中保持最小的环境足迹。这项工作填补了电氧化系统中EMSI效应和共催化之间的理论空白,同时为废水净化提供了一种强大的技术解决方案。
